美文网首页
matlab技巧

matlab技巧

作者: 追忆__ | 来源:发表于2019-08-08 10:50 被阅读0次

    1

    subplot时,加总标题:使用suptitle命令,但不能设置字体,需要手动设置。

    2

    plot出来图片后,选中那个光标按钮(Edit Plot),即可拖动图例的位置

    3

    为了满足投稿要求,图片的字体、大小需要调整,方法如下:
    https://blog.csdn.net/u013346007/article/details/71104031
    使用上文方法调整subplot所作的图时,需要在每个subplot下都写一遍程序。但是set gcf只有最后一个起作用。
    此外,建议不使用:

    set(get(gca,'XLabel'),'FontSize',figure_FontSize,'Vertical','top');
    set(get(gca,'YLabel'),'FontSize',figure_FontSize,'Vertical','middle');
    

    因为这两句会使得X,Y轴的label过于靠近标度,显得很拥挤。
    可改为:

    set(get(gca,'XLabel'),'FontSize',figure_FontSize);
    set(get(gca,'YLabel'),'FontSize',figure_FontSize);
    

    一般 只需要set gcf ,不用set gca
    set gcf应使用下面的语句

    set(gcf,'Units','centimeters','Position',[6 0 10 24]);
    

    前两个数字代表图片在屏幕中的位置,以屏幕左下角为原点,第一个数字为x方向位置,第二个数字为y方向位置
    后两个数字代表图片的长和宽,单位为cm

    设置字体时,如果图片要求10号字,可以在matlab中设置为18号字,如果偏大再缩小。

    4

    如果图片中边框不全,使用:box on;

    5

    手动编辑图片时,可以直接点击工具条最后一个图标(show plot tools and dock figure)进入编辑状态,编辑完成后,点击倒数第2个图标(hide plot tools)退出编辑状态

    相关文章

      网友评论

          本文标题:matlab技巧

          本文链接:https://www.haomeiwen.com/subject/aebtjctx.html